Globalized Culture and its Impact

Introduction to Globalization

  • Globalization has merged world cultures into a globalized culture.
  • Driven by new communication and transportation technologies (internet, air travel).
  • Rise of a recognizable global culture with strong Western cultural influences.
  • Local cultures are influenced by but not erased by this global culture.

Influence on the Arts

  • Music:
    • Reggae: Originating from Jamaica, popularized globally by Bob Marley.
    • K-pop: South Korean music style that became a global phenomenon through social media.
  • Entertainment:
    • Dominance of American films through Hollywood.
    • Films like Avengers: Endgame demonstrate global reach and potential cultural imperialism.
    • Bollywood as a significant film industry with global reach, especially in South Asia and the Middle East.

Globalized Sports

  • Spectator sports became global in the 20th century due to events like the Olympics and FIFA World Cup.
  • These events promote both internationalism and nationalism.
  • Olympics watched by over 3 billion people; World Cup with 1.5 billion viewers.

Rise of Global Consumer Culture

  • Post-World War II shift of US industry to consumer goods production.
  • America influenced global consumer culture through mass-produced goods and advertising.
  • Global brands:
    • American Brands: McDonald's, KFC, Coca-Cola.
    • Fun Fact: China has the highest concentration of KFC restaurants.
    • Non-American Brands: Toyota, a Japanese multinational corporation.
  • Online Retailers:
    • Alibaba: Chinese online retailer with global reach.
    • eBay: American online auction platform with a significant global user base.

Conclusion

  • Globalization has led to a merged global culture with strong Western influences.
  • Local cultures adapt and integrate global elements in arts, entertainment, sports, and consumer habits.
